Can't get the game
A friend of mine said I could get this game by using this url and clicking install - https://steamdb.info/app/958260/ but when I try that it just says "No License"

I never had issues reinstalling this game. I used a VPN: such as Tunnelbear or Windscribe, set it to Singapore and went to SteamDB with the link provided below to install.
https://steamdb.info/app/958260/

Then I uninstalled the VPN before starting the game.
If Singapore isn't an option, try Hong Kong instead.

VPN is required due to the developer region-blocking the game to the west.

You won't get banned for using the VPN during the install process, but just make sure it's turned off before making any in-game purchases.

It is considered safe since lots of user here using VPN to play the game. You will get banned if you purchase something from Steam using VPN, to fork your way getting some games cheaper in another region. This game however F2P, buying something in-game do not count as buying a game from Steam.
